/third_party/mesa3d/src/panfrost/vulkan/ |
D | panvk_varyings.h | 61 struct panvk_varying varying[VARYING_SLOT_MAX]; 62 BITSET_DECLARE(active, VARYING_SLOT_MAX); 63 struct panvk_varying_buf buf[VARYING_SLOT_MAX]; 66 gl_varying_slot loc[VARYING_SLOT_MAX];
|
/third_party/mesa3d/src/intel/compiler/ |
D | brw_vue_map.c | 286 if (slot < VARYING_SLOT_MAX) in varying_name() 290 [BRW_VARYING_SLOT_NDC - VARYING_SLOT_MAX] = "BRW_VARYING_SLOT_NDC", in varying_name() 291 [BRW_VARYING_SLOT_PAD - VARYING_SLOT_MAX] = "BRW_VARYING_SLOT_PAD", in varying_name() 292 [BRW_VARYING_SLOT_PNTC - VARYING_SLOT_MAX] = "BRW_VARYING_SLOT_PNTC", in varying_name() 295 return brw_names[slot - VARYING_SLOT_MAX]; in varying_name()
|
D | brw_compiler.h | 945 int urb_setup[VARYING_SLOT_MAX]; 952 uint8_t urb_setup_attribs[VARYING_SLOT_MAX]; 1126 BRW_VARYING_SLOT_NDC = VARYING_SLOT_MAX, 1151 (BITFIELD64_RANGE(0, VARYING_SLOT_MAX) & \ 1445 int32_t start_dw[VARYING_SLOT_MAX];
|
D | brw_mesh.cpp | 353 for (int i = 0; i < VARYING_SLOT_MAX; i++) in brw_compute_mue_map() 488 for (unsigned i = 0; i < VARYING_SLOT_MAX; i++) { in brw_print_mue_map() 506 for (unsigned i = 0; i < VARYING_SLOT_MAX; i++) { in brw_print_mue_map()
|
D | brw_clip_util.c | 259 } else if (varying < VARYING_SLOT_MAX) { in brw_clip_interp_vertex()
|
D | brw_fs.h | 380 fs_reg outputs[VARYING_SLOT_MAX];
|
/third_party/mesa3d/src/amd/compiler/ |
D | aco_instruction_selection.h | 46 uint8_t mask[VARYING_SLOT_MAX]; 47 Temp temps[VARYING_SLOT_MAX * 4u]; 52 std::fill_n(temps, VARYING_SLOT_MAX * 4u, Temp(0, RegClass::v1)); in shader_io_state()
|
D | aco_shader_info.h | 73 uint8_t vs_output_param_offset[VARYING_SLOT_MAX];
|
/third_party/mesa3d/src/gallium/drivers/d3d12/ |
D | d3d12_lower_point_sprite.c | 37 nir_variable *varying_out[VARYING_SLOT_MAX]; 45 nir_ssa_def *varying[VARYING_SLOT_MAX]; 46 unsigned varying_write_mask[VARYING_SLOT_MAX]; 168 for (unsigned slot = 0; slot < VARYING_SLOT_MAX; ++slot) { in lower_emit_vertex() 209 for (unsigned i = 0; i < VARYING_SLOT_MAX; ++i) in lower_emit_vertex()
|
D | d3d12_nir_passes.c | 799 for (int i = 0; i < VARYING_SLOT_MAX; ++i) { in lower_triangle_strip_emit_vertex() 808 for (int i = 0; i < VARYING_SLOT_MAX; ++i) { in lower_triangle_strip_emit_vertex() 841 nir_variable *tmp_vars[VARYING_SLOT_MAX] = {0}; in d3d12_lower_triangle_strip() 842 nir_variable *out_vars[VARYING_SLOT_MAX] = {0}; in d3d12_lower_triangle_strip() 983 struct multistream_var_state vars[VARYING_SLOT_MAX];
|
D | d3d12_compiler.h | 77 } slots[VARYING_SLOT_MAX];
|
D | d3d12_gs_variant.cpp | 151 nir_variable *in[VARYING_SLOT_MAX]; 152 nir_variable *out[VARYING_SLOT_MAX];
|
/third_party/mesa3d/src/freedreno/ir3/ |
D | ir3_shader.h | 1128 #define VARYING_SLOT_GS_HEADER_IR3 (VARYING_SLOT_MAX + 0) 1129 #define VARYING_SLOT_GS_VERTEX_FLAGS_IR3 (VARYING_SLOT_MAX + 1) 1130 #define VARYING_SLOT_TCS_HEADER_IR3 (VARYING_SLOT_MAX + 2) 1131 #define VARYING_SLOT_REL_PATCH_ID_IR3 (VARYING_SLOT_MAX + 3)
|
/third_party/mesa3d/src/amd/common/ |
D | ac_nir_lower_ngg.c | 83 nir_variable *output_vars[VARYING_SLOT_MAX][4]; 97 gs_output_info output_info[VARYING_SLOT_MAX]; 159 nir_variable *out_variables[VARYING_SLOT_MAX * 4]; 167 } output_info[VARYING_SLOT_MAX]; 1674 assert((base + base_offset) < VARYING_SLOT_MAX); in lower_ngg_gs_store_output() 1735 for (unsigned slot = 0; slot < VARYING_SLOT_MAX; ++slot) { in lower_ngg_gs_emit_vertex_with_counter() 1894 uint8_t out_bitsizes[VARYING_SLOT_MAX]; in ngg_gs_export_vertices() 1895 memset(out_bitsizes, 32, VARYING_SLOT_MAX); in ngg_gs_export_vertices() 1903 for (unsigned slot = 0; slot < VARYING_SLOT_MAX; ++slot) { in ngg_gs_export_vertices() 2088 for (unsigned slot = 0; slot < VARYING_SLOT_MAX; ++slot) { in ac_nir_lower_ngg_gs()
|
/third_party/mesa3d/src/mesa/program/ |
D | prog_print.c | 192 STATIC_ASSERT(ARRAY_SIZE(fragAttribs) == VARYING_SLOT_MAX); in arb_input_attrib_string() 338 STATIC_ASSERT(ARRAY_SIZE(vertResults) == VARYING_SLOT_MAX); in arb_output_attrib_string()
|
D | prog_to_nir.c | 55 nir_variable *input_vars[VARYING_SLOT_MAX]; 56 nir_variable *output_vars[VARYING_SLOT_MAX]; 142 assert(prog_src->Index >= 0 && prog_src->Index < VARYING_SLOT_MAX); in ptn_get_src()
|
/third_party/mesa3d/src/mesa/main/ |
D | shader_types.h | 710 ubyte result_to_output[VARYING_SLOT_MAX];
|
D | context.c | 625 assert(VARYING_SLOT_MAX <= in check_context_limits() 627 assert(VARYING_SLOT_MAX <= in check_context_limits()
|
/third_party/mesa3d/src/compiler/glsl/ |
D | ir_set_program_inouts.cpp | 108 assert(idx < VARYING_SLOT_MAX); in mark()
|
/third_party/mesa3d/src/compiler/ |
D | shader_enums.c | 254 STATIC_ASSERT(ARRAY_SIZE(names) == VARYING_SLOT_MAX); in gl_varying_slot_name_for_stage()
|
D | shader_enums.h | 439 #define VARYING_SLOT_MAX (VARYING_SLOT_VAR0 + MAX_VARYING) macro
|
/third_party/mesa3d/src/microsoft/compiler/ |
D | dxil_signature.c | 589 assert(num_inputs < VARYING_SLOT_MAX); in get_input_signature_group() 780 const struct dxil_mdnode *nodes[VARYING_SLOT_MAX]; in get_signature_metadata()
|
/third_party/mesa3d/src/gallium/drivers/zink/ |
D | zink_compiler.c | 824 uint8_t reverse_map[VARYING_SLOT_MAX] = {0}; in update_so_info() 841 bool inlined[VARYING_SLOT_MAX][4] = {0}; in update_so_info() 843 uint8_t packed_components[VARYING_SLOT_MAX] = {0}; in update_so_info() 844 uint8_t packed_streams[VARYING_SLOT_MAX] = {0}; in update_so_info() 845 uint8_t packed_buffers[VARYING_SLOT_MAX] = {0}; in update_so_info() 846 uint16_t packed_offsets[VARYING_SLOT_MAX][4] = {0}; in update_so_info() 1483 unsigned char slot_map[VARYING_SLOT_MAX]; in zink_compiler_assign_io()
|
/third_party/mesa3d/src/mesa/state_tracker/ |
D | st_program.c | 442 for (unsigned attr = 0; attr < VARYING_SLOT_MAX; attr++) { in st_prepare_vertex_program() 462 for (unsigned attr = 0; attr < VARYING_SLOT_MAX; attr++) { in st_translate_stream_output_info()
|
/third_party/mesa3d/src/amd/vulkan/ |
D | radv_shader.h | 201 uint8_t vs_output_param_offset[VARYING_SLOT_MAX];
|